Abstract

The practice of polygamy has existed long before Islam and has become a permissible custom. Unfortunately, many people assume that polygamy is a practice that was only known after the arrival of Islam. Ironically, Islam is considered to monopolize and legalize polygamy. In reality, Islam came by providing restrictions on polygamous marriages with certain limitations. Justice in polygamy is an obligation that must receive special attention, because the word "fair" is very easy to say but difficult to implement. In this study, the author focuses on the verses of the Qur'an related to polygamy, namely; Surah An-Nisa' verse 3. This type of research is entirely library research taking data from literature related to the research theme. The analysis technique in this writing uses a content analysis model by exploring and analyzing the thoughts or views of scholars on the verses of the Qur'an related to polygamy.

Abstract

In married life, the husband should be able to position his wife as a balanced and equal partner. Not only as a complement to life and sexual satisfaction alone. A husband has the responsibility to help his wife's work, and vice versa, the wife must take part in helping to bear the burden of responsibility to relieve her husband. Husbands may not claim the right of "special services" regardless of the physical or psychological condition of the wife, on the pretext of the Prophet's hadith. From here, it is important to review the hadiths related to the curse of angels on wives who refuse husbands' invitations, to get a comprehensive meaning. This study uses a thematic method with a descriptive analysis approach to the texts of the Prophet's traditions relating to the intervention of angels in husband-wife sexual relations. That is by compiling hadiths related to the theme of the discussion, and tracing the asbab wurud, matan, and the hadith sanad.
